Spinach and Chicken Quesadilla



Enjoy a delicious and low-carb Spinach and Chicken Quesadilla packed with protein and veggies. Perfect for a quick and healthy meal!

Ingredients:

  • 2 low carb tortillas
  • 1 cup cooked chicken breast, shredded
  • 1 cup fresh spinach leaves
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/4 cup diced tomatoes
  • 1/4 cup diced red onion
  • 1/4 cup diced bell pepper
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 1/4 cup salsa
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

Put the olive oil in a nonstick skillet and heat it over medium-low heat

In a skillet, put one tortilla in the pan and sprinkle half of the shredded cheddar cheese over it

On top of the cheese, put the cooked chicken, spinach leaves, tomatoes, red onion, and bell pepper that have been diced

Add pepper and salt to taste

To make the second tortilla, put it on top and quickly press it down

As soon as the cheese melts and the tortillas turn golden brown, flip them over and cook for another two to three minutes

Take it out of the pan and let it cool for one minute

It goes well with sour cream and salsa, which you can get on the side

Slow Cooker Ham White Bean Soup

Dried white beans and leftover ham are cooked slowly in a savory broth to make this hearty and comforting soup. Ingredients: 1 lb dried white beans, rinsed and sorted 1 ham hock or leftover ham bone 1 onion, diced 3 cloves garlic, minced 2 carrots, diced 2 celery stalks, diced 6 cups chicken or vegetable broth 1 teaspoon dried thyme 1 bay leaf Salt and pepper to taste Fresh parsley for garnish optional Instructions: In a slow cooker, put everything but the parsley For 8 to 10 hours on low heat or 4 to 6 hours on high, until the beans are soft and the soup tastes good To make the soup more filling, shred the meat and add it back to the ham hock or bone Delete the bay leaf Depending on your taste, add salt and pepper Serve hot, and if you want, top with fresh parsley

RAW VEGAN Caramel-Covered Bananas

Indulge in this guilt-free treat! These caramel-covered bananas are not only delicious but also raw and vegan-friendly. Ingredients: 4 ripe bananas 10 medjool dates, pitted 2 tablespoons almond butter 1 teaspoon vanilla extract 1/4 cup coconut oil, melted Pinch of sea salt Instructions: Slice bananas into bite-sized pieces and place them on a parchment-lined baking sheet In a food processor, blend dates, almond butter, vanilla extract, melted coconut oil, and sea salt until smooth Dip each banana slice into the caramel mixture, coating it completely Place the coated banana slices back on the parchment-lined baking sheet Freeze for at least 1 hour until the caramel hardens Serve and enjoy!
